Why do we start the formula with + or -
 

Hi everybody,

I have noticed that some people start the formula with + or - after
equal sign e.g. =+if(...

My question is: what is the main purpose of doing that I need a
detaild answer with some examples if available.

JMB

hope i'm not raining on someones homework. it is a carryover from lotus 123.
if you enter +sum(A1:A5), excel automatically throws in the = sign, but
leaves the + sign.

Dave Peterson

When we switched from Lotus 123 to Excel, there were a lot of 123 users who
couldn't break that habit.

(I find it irritating, too <vbg.)

Another one that lots of lotus users did (ok a few, ok just one!) was:

=sum(a1+b1)
or even worse:
=+sum(a1+b1)
